body{
margin:0px;
padding:0px;
background-color:#7D8CAA;
}

body, td {
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:9pt;
color:#142F64;}

a{
text-decoration:none;
color: #142F64;
background-color:transparent;
}

a:hover { 
text-decoration:underline; 
color: #f00; 
background-color:transparent;
  }

a.navi,
a.navi:hover{ 
text-decoration: none;
color: #ffffff;
background-color:transparent;
}

a.news{ 
text-decoration:none;      
color:#142F64; 
background-color:transparent;
}

a.news:hover{ 
text-decoration:none;
color:#777;
background-color:transparent;
}

a.footer{ 
text-decoration:none;
color: #FFF; 
background-color:transparent;
}

a.footer:hover{ 
text-decoration:underline;   
background-color:transparent;   
}

@media print {
.druck { 
display:none;
background-color:transparent;
}
}

form{
margin:0px;
background-color:transparent;
padding:0px;
}

small,
.small{
font-size:10px;
background-color:transparent;
}

.white{
color:#fff;
}

.blue{
background-color:transparent;
color:#036;
}



.top, .top a{
color:#fff;
padding:2px;
font-size:7pt;
}

#logo{
background-image:url(logo_junge_union.jpg);
background-repeat:no-repeat;
text-align:right;
vertical-align:top;
font-size:7pt;
color:#fff;
padding:2px 2px 0px 0px;
}
#logo a {
font-size:7pt;
color:#fff;
text-decoration:none;
}

.smallhead{
color:#fff;
font-size:7pt;
font-weight:bold;
}

.navtable{
background-image:url(nav_bg.jpg);
border:0px;
width:100%;
margin:0px;
padding:0px;
}

.linieoben{
border-top:1px solid #bbb;
background-color:transparent;
}

.linieunten{
border-bottom:1px solid #bbb;
background-color:transparent;
}

td.infohead{
font-size:11px;
color:#fff;
background-color:#4B6491;
font-weight:bold;
padding:0px 0px 0px 3px;
}

.navtable{
border:0px;
}

/* Navi */

#nav ul{
list-style-type:none;
margin:0px;
padding:0px;
background-image:url(nav_bg.jpg);
}

#nav ul li{
padding:1px 0px;
margin:0px;
}


#nav ul li#active{
margin:0px;
border:0px;
line-height:15px;
}

#nav ul li.subnavi{
}

#nav ul li a{
font-size:8pt;
color:rgb(255,255,255);
display:block;
padding:3px 0px 3px 10px;
text-decoration:none;
line-height:15px;
}

#nav ul li a:hover{
border:1px solid #fff;
color:rgb(255,255,255);

line-height:13px;
}

#nav ul li#active a{
color:rgb(255,255,255);
padding:3px 0px 3px 10px;
line-height:15px;
}

#nav ul li#active a:hover{
padding:2px 0px 2px 9px;
}


#nav ul li.subnavi a{
color:rgb(255,255,255);
font-size:8pt;
padding:2px 0px 2px 15px;
line-height:15px;
}


#nav ul li.subnavi a:hover{
line-height:13px;
border:1px solid #fff;

}

#nav ul li.subnavi a#active{
color:rgb(255,255,255);
line-height:15px;
}


/* Navi Ende */

